About

Concours Beursault is a regional Beursault target archery competition held on 18 and 19 July 2026 in Pechbonnieu, France. Organized by Les Archers Frontonnais, this event is qualifying for the French National Championships and welcomes licensed FFTA archers in all eligible categories and divisions.

The tournament takes place at the Jeu d'arc des Archers de Pechbonnieu and follows official FFTA Beursault rules. Each shooting session consists of 20 haltes, for a total of 40 arrows, plus two practice haltes.

Competition format:
- Beursault round
- 20 haltes (40 scoring arrows)
- 2 practice haltes
- Distances: 50 m, and 30 m for U13 and U15 categories
- Maximum of two pelotons of five archers per departure
